Nigerian Post publisher wins Journalist of the year award

By Noah Ocheni, Lokoja

The publisher of Nigeria Post, Comrade Mike Abuh has bagged icon award from Advocacy for Youth Leadership in Governance in kogi state.

Presenting the award on Tuesday in Lokoja, kogi state capital, the chairman of the Organisation, Mr. Abiodun Ajinomo said the award was based on the track records of Mr. Mike Abuh who has contributed immensely for the growth of the youth across the state.

He said the recipient has used his medium to champion the cause of youth that has inculcated in them the confidence and reselience to unleash potentials embedded in them to making the society a better place to live in.

“This is in recognition of his contributions to the growth of Journalism practice and overall, Peace and Youth development of the Society.”

In his remark, the Publisher of Nigeria post newspaper, Comrade Mike Abu commended the organisers of the award for selecting him, stressing that he never believed that his modest contribution to the society could get the attention of the society that could earned him an award.

The awardee promise to work harder to improve the lots of the society urging persons with means to consider the good of the society rather than personal consideration.

Amongst those who bagged different awards at the event includes, the Acting Rector kogi state Polytechnic Dr. Salisu Usman Ogbo, kogi state Commissioner for Solid Minerals Engineer Bashir Gegu and host of other recipients.
